    Real-Time Action: The Power of Two-Way Satellite Communication

    Fast Facts

    1. Enhanced Connectivity: Two-way satellite communications use Earth stations for both uplink and downlink, enabling affordable, resilient global connectivity, especially critical for IoT applications.

    2. LEO Advantages: Low Earth Orbit (LEO) satellites significantly reduce latency (20-50 ms) compared to geostationary satellites, facilitating faster and cheaper deployments for two-way communication services.

    3. Market Growth: The satellite IoT market is expected to grow at a 23.8% CAGR (2023-2030), driven by new services like satellite broadband and direct-to-device communications that support real-time data interactions.

    4. Transformative Use Cases: Two-way satellite communications empower sectors like agriculture and emergency response by enabling real-time data exchange and responsive actions, while offering a reliable alternative where cellular coverage is inadequate.

    Advancements in Two-Way Satellite Technology

    Two-way satellite communication represents a significant leap in connectivity. Unlike traditional systems, this technology relies on Earth stations that facilitate both uplink and downlink functions. As a result, users benefit from affordable and resilient connectivity for critical assets worldwide. The rise of low Earth orbit (LEO) satellite constellations has fueled this growth. These satellites orbit between 500 and 2,000 kilometers, drastically reducing the distance to the satellite compared to geostationary options. This proximity shortens latency to between 20 and 50 milliseconds, enhancing real-time communication.

    Furthermore, analyst firm Omdia predicts a substantial increase in satellite IoT revenues. The expected growth rate of 23.8% from 2023 to 2030 indicates a booming market poised for action. Two-way capabilities enable devices to not only send data but also receive instructions. This advancement opens new avenues for automation. For instance, real-time alerts can optimize machinery operations, and remote diagnostics can minimize the need for site visits, thus maximizing uptime.

    Bridging Connectivity Gaps in Real-Time

    The evolution of two-way satellite systems brings together the best aspects of satellite and cellular technologies. Many users will now find a reliable communication solution in areas where cellular coverage is lacking. This includes vast deserts, dense jungles, and remote ocean sites. The integration of cost-effective LEO satellites enhances data flow across various industries, such as agriculture, utilities, and emergency response.

    Organizations increasingly depend on secure connectivity for their IoT operations. The ability to report data and receive instructions in real-time is invaluable. These advancements break through previous barriers, allowing higher device deployments without the complexities once associated with satellite communications. As the world embraces this technology, the potential for action-driven, real-time communication becomes a reality for countless applications.
